This is a printhead with drop size of between 2.5 - 9pl and 600dpi native resolution.
2.5pl drop size allows excellent print quality without graininess.With 1,280 nozzles configured in 4 x 150dpi rows, this printhead achieves high-resolution 600dpi printing. Additionally, the ink paths are isolated, enabling a single printhead to jet up to two ink colors.
Achieves excellent grey-scale rendering at up to 4 levels.
Ricoh inkjet printheads are made of stainless steel. These printheads are highly robust and offer excellent anti-corrosion properties for multiple inks, resulting in excellent durability and extended service life.
With its built-in heater, these printheads are capable of jetting high-viscosity inks. Additionally, the ink path is isolated from the actuator (piezo elements) , i.e. no ink contact.
Ricoh's open waveform policy allows tailored multi-drop printing of between 2.5 - 9pl, enabling high quality greyscale printing.
RICOH MH5220
| RICOH MH5220 | |
|---|---|
| Method |
Piston pusher with metallic diaphragm plate
|
| Print Width |
54.1 mm(2.1")
|
| Number of nozzles |
1,280 (4 x 320 channels), staggered
|
| Nozzle spacing (4 color printing) |
1/150"(0.1693 mm)
|
| Nozzle spacing (Row to row distance) |
0.93 mm
|
| Nozzle spacing (Upper and lower swath distance) |
9.31mm
|
| Compatible ink |
UV
|
| Total printhead dimensions |
89(W) x 24.5(D) x 66.3(H) mm (3.5" x 1.0" x 2.6") excluding cables & connectors
|
| Weight |
142g
|
| Max.number of color inks |
2 colors
|
| Operating temperature range |
Up to 50℃
|
| Temperature control |
Integrated heater and thermistor
|
| Life |
100 billion actuations per nozzle
|
| Jetting frequency |
30kHz
|
Drop volume
|
Binary mode: 2.5pl / Grey-scale mode : 2.5 - 9pl *depending on the ink
|
| Viscosity range |
10-12 mPa⋅s
|
| Surface tension |
28-35mN/m
|
Grey-scale
|
4 levels
|
| Ink port |
Yes
|
| Number of ink ports |
2 x dual ports
|
| Alignment pin direction |
Front (standard)
|
| Separately sold parts |
FPC cable with connectors
|
